Abstract

An expression is derived for Coulomb oscillations of conductance of the single-electron tunneling (SET) transistor in the "metallic" regime, when the discreteness of the single-particle energy spectrum of the electrodes is negligible. This expression describes in a unified way both the conductance maxima which are determined by the "classical" sequential electron tunneling, and conductance minima determined by the macroscopic quantum tunneling of electric charge.
